Summary of the comparison

Willesborough Infant School and Brook Community Primary School are primary schools in Ashford.

  • Willesborough Infant School scores 68 out of 100 (grade C, average) and Brook Community Primary School scores 50 out of 100 (grade D, below average). Willesborough Infant School is ahead on our composite score.

  • Willesborough Infant School was judged Good and Brook Community Primary School was judged Good.

  • The share of pupils meeting the expected standard at Key Stage 2 has risen at Brook Community Primary School (56.0% in 2022-23, 62.0% in 2024-25).
